深入浅出 PS 脚本编程代码大全377


如何在 Adobe Photoshop 中使用脚本来自动执行任务、提高效率以及拓展可能性?本文将呈现一份全面的 PS 脚本编程代码大全,涵盖各个方面的实用代码示例。无论是初学者还是经验丰富的脚本编写者,都能从中找到所需的知识和灵感。## 基本操作

创建和保存脚本

```
// 创建新文档
newDoc(width, height, resolution);
// 打开文件
open("path/to/");
// 保存文件
save("path/to/");
```

选择和操作图层

```
// 选中图层
selectLayerByName("Layer Name");
// 创建新图层
createLayer("New Layer");
// 合并图层
mergeLayers();
// 删除图层
deleteLayer();
```## 图像处理

调整颜色和色调

```
// 调整亮度
adjustBrightness(value);
// 调整对比度
adjustContrast(value);
// 调整色相
adjustHue(value);
```

应用滤镜

```
// 应用高斯模糊
applyGaussianBlur(radius);
// 应用锐化滤镜
applySharpen(amount);
// 应用马赛克滤镜
applyMosaic(cellSize);
```

合成和操作

```
// 创建蒙版
createMask();
// 裁剪图像
crop(left, top, right, bottom);
// 旋转图像
rotate(angle);
```## 交互和自动化

获取用户输入

```
// 显示对话框并获取用户输入
dialogMessage(message, title, buttonLabels);
// 显示颜色拾取器并获取用户选择的颜色
dialogColorPicker(message, title);
```

批处理操作

```
// 打开并应用脚本到一组文件中
batchOpen(files, scriptFile);
// 保存批处理结果文件
batchSave();
```## 高级技巧

脚本调试

```
// 设置断点
debugger();
// 输出日志消息
("Log Message");
```

创建自定义函数

```
// 定义可重用函数
function myFunction(parameters) {
// 函数代码
}
```

使用第三方库

通过使用第三方库,可以扩展 PS 脚本的可能性。例如,ScriptUI 库可用于创建用户友好的界面和复杂的工作流。## 结语
掌握 PS 脚本编程可以大大提升您的图像处理效率和创作能力。本文提供的代码大全仅是开始,鼓励您继续探索和学习,发挥脚本编程的无限潜力。通过巧妙地运用这些技巧,您可以将自己的图像编辑工作流提升到一个新的水平。

2025-01-31


上一篇:编程猫所有脚本

下一篇:如何自学编程编写脚本